Abstract

520,088. Rock drills. HAIG, D. M. (Eidco, Inc.), Oct. 12, 1938, No. 29484. [Class 124] In a rock drill the bit comprises a hollow head 10 flattened on opposite sides and having a conical depression providing diametrically opposed arcuate reaming edges 17, and one or more cutter portions 13 within the conical depression. The reaming edges lie substantially on the same circle, and the under surface of the head 10 may be of double conical formation, as shown at 37. The cutters 13 may be elliptical, straight sided with chisel edges 16, or they may be of cross, rose, or other shape. They may lead or follow the reaming edge in the cutting operation, and they may have tapered shanks 14 for attachment to the head by friction joints, or they may be attached by the usual screwthreaded connections. They may be made in two or more axially split parts, and their plane surfaces may be at equal or unequal angles to their axes. They may be formed with fluid passages which discharge on their opposite sides. The head 10 may be removed from the tapered portion 2 of a drill rod by means of a U-shaped wedge member 21 which engages astride the rod and fits between the bit head and inclined portions 22 on opposite sides of an integral or rigidly fixed buttress ring 20. The drill rod comprises a number of sections 1 provided at each end with a female member 5 or a serrated male member 2 adapted to make a friction joint with a corresponding male or female member on the next section or on a coupling member 7. Each male member 2 may have a steep portion O with inclined shoulders 4.on opposite sides to provide angular flat portions 3 adapted to accommodate a wedge for separating the two parts. The serrations may be parallel to the axis of the rod or bit, inclined thereto, or crossing each other, and the inside of the sockets may be made softer relatively to the outer surfaces and cutting edges.
